Strengthening China-Vietnam Relations

Chinese President Xi Jinping's state visit to Vietnam emphasized the importance of strong bilateral ties, which he described as a model of friendly cooperation. During his meetings with Vietnamese leaders, including General Secretary Luang Kong, Xi proposed six strategic measures aimed at enhancing mutual trust and collaboration across various sectors. These measures included expanding high-quality cooperation, prioritizing security and regional stability, and fostering closer people-to-people exchanges. The visit culminated in the signing of 45 cooperation documents that cover a wide range of sectors, aiming to deepen the comprehensive strategic partnership between the two nations.
